class Comment(db.Model):
    __tablename__ = 'comments'
    id = db.Column(db.Integer, primary_key=True,
                   autoincrement=True)  # 评论的ID,设为主键
    content = db.Column(db.String(1024))  # 评论内容
    status = db.Column(db.Integer, default=0)  # 评论的状态,0表示正常,1表示被删除;默认为0
    user_id = db.Column(db.Integer, db.ForeignKey('users.id'))
    # 该评论是哪个人(users.id)评论的,跟users表中的主键id有关联,需要用到users.id的值,则用ForeignKey函数;类似于某个表
    # 的某个键值需要用到其他表的键值时,就要用ForeignKey这样的函数;比如上面的images.id需要用到users.id一个道理;
    # ForeignKey仅仅是取其他表中键的值,而并非关联起来,是表1的id用了表2的id,则用ForeignKey拷过来;若是关联,则用relationship

    image_id = db.Column(db.Integer, db.ForeignKey('images.id'))
    # ForeignKey仅仅是取其他表中键的值,而并非关联起来,是表1的id用了表2的id,则用ForeignKey拷过来;若是关联,则用relationship
    # 该评论是评给哪个图的,跟上面一个道理,需要关联images.id中的键值,要用ForeignKey函数进行取images.id中的值;
    # 即comments.image_id跟images.id关联起来了;

    users = db.relationship('User')

    # 含义解释:将两个表(Comment与User)关联起来了,表示Comment中的users是从User类来的;
    # 表示一个评论(当前的类/表)要跟User(要关联的东西)关联起来,用relationgship关联;
    # ForeignKey仅仅是取其他表中键的值,而并非关联起来,是表1的id用了表2的id,则用ForeignKey拷过来;若是关联,则用relationship

    # 构造函数
    def __init__(self, content, image_id, user_id):
        self.content = content
        self.image_id = image_id
        self.user_id = user_id

    # 查询函数(Comment.query())数据查询后的内容和格式就是__repr__函数定义的,比如这里查询出来的只有评论id 和 评论内容;
    def __repr__(self):
        return '[Comment %d %s]' % (self.id, self.content)
